项目摘要

The DOT Power Platform (DOT) is a newly developed approach to autonomous agriculture with independent,**four-wheel steering. This results in a high degree of potential maneuverability. However, to take full advantage**of these capabilities, standard left-right type steering controls are inadequate. This collaborative project will**develop candidate controller strategies and test them on a smaller vehicle with similar maneuverability**characteristics as DOT, developed independently at the University of Saskatchewan.**Developed in Canada, DOT has generated global interest as a paradigm-shifting technology in the move toward**more automated agriculture. This project will contribute to the usability of the system and operator confidence,**aiding with early adoption. The success of the platform will, in turn, foster job growth in Canadian R&D and**manufacturing of compatible equipment, and address the growing issues of labor availability in rural areas.
